New nasal spray aims to stop asthma Flare-Ups triggered by common cold

This study tests a nasal spray called RIG-101 in healthy people and those with asthma. First, it checks safety and tolerability. Then, asthma participants receive the spray daily and are exposed to a cold virus to see if it prevents asthma worsening. The trial is recruiting 82 ad…
Phase: PHASE1, PHASE2 • Sponsor: RIGImmune Inc. • Aim: Disease control
